Pacific American Academy Charter School

Pacific American Academy Charter SchoolThe Pacific American Education and Scholastic Foundation (PAESF) is a nonprofit that brings awareness and understanding of the shared core values that bridge the disparity between the values of society and cultural roots through celebrating Pacific Islander values, multiculturalism, healthy families, and education. “Take up the conch and canoe to live life and to navigate our future.” PAESF encompasses many programs, including the Pacific American Academy Charter School.

The Pacific American Academy Charter School is a FREE Public Charter School serving grades from K – 6. The mission of the Pacific American Academy Charter School is to maintain a quality education program, which encompasses the pride in, and understanding of, diverse cultures.

The Pacific American Community Cultural Center, with the help of PA’A San Diego Founder and Executive Director, Margaret Sanborn, is seeking to build a sister charter school and become the second school on the mainland to promote Pacific Island culture based education, as well as conventional learning methods.
